Mt. Airy Chiropractic is the Germantown Avenue practice of Dr. Rachel Pawlikowski, a family wellness chiropractor in Philadelphia. The office states that it recognizes everyone is much more than the sum of his or her parts and honors the wholeness of the person across mind, body and spirit, with an aim of inspiring the community to trust the healer within and to live an integrated life. Adjustments are done by hand and are built around Bio-Geometric Integration, a gentle approach that uses the body's own geometry as a precise means of analyzing and adjusting for subluxations, and that assists the body to use physical, chemical and mental or emotional stress in a positive and productive manner instead of trying to eliminate or manage it. The practice describes the adjustment as unique to each person and based on your body's specific, individualized needs, with the focus placed on optimizing the health of your nerve system rather than on a list of ailments. Dr. Rachel earned a bachelor's degree in Interdisciplinary Health Services at St. Joseph's University, became initiated in Reiki, studied and practiced massage therapy, and went on to earn her Doctorate of Chiropractic at Life University in Marietta, Georgia. She is Webster Technique certified for pre-natal chiropractic care and is also well versed in extremity adjusting, Network Spinal Analysis and Sacro-Occipital Technique, and she works with people of all ages. On a first visit she reviews your health history, completes a spinal exam and discusses your health goals. The office is an out of network provider and is happy to work with you to be directly reimbursed by your insurance company by providing super-bills on request. If care uncovers non-chiropractic or unusual findings, the practice will advise you and recommend that you seek the services of another healthcare provider.
